St. Johns Investment Management Company LLC Has $1.39 Million Holdings in CocaCola Company (The) (NYSE:KO)

CocaCola logo with Consumer Staples background

St. Johns Investment Management Company LLC reduced its holdings in CocaCola Company (The) (NYSE:KO - Free Report) by 50.8%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 19,342 shares of the company's stock after selling 19,937 shares during the period. St. Johns Investment Management Company LLC's holdings in CocaCola were worth $1,385,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

CocaCola Price Performance

NYSE KO traded down $0.55 during trading on Wednesday, hitting $69.66. 12,536,081 shares of the company's st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 16,001,740. The company has a market cap of $299.84 billion, a PE ratio of 27.86, a P/E/G ratio of 3.66 and a beta of 0.46. The company has a current ratio of 1.10, a quick ratio of 0.89 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.57. CocaCola Company has a fifty-two week low of $60.62 and a fifty-two week high of $74.38. The stock's 50 day moving average price is $71.42 and its two-hundred day moving average price is $68.17.

CocaCola (NYSE:KO -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, April 29th. The company reported $0.73 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$0.71 by $0.02. The business had revenue of $11.13 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$11.23 billion. CocaCola had a net margin of 23.00% and a return on equity of 45.49%. The firm's quarterly revenue was down .7%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the company earned $0.72 EPS. Research analysts expect that CocaCola Company will post 2.96 EPS for the current year.

CocaCola Announces Dividend

The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, July 1st. Stockholders of record on Friday, June 13th will be issued a dividend of $0.51 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, June 13th. This represents a $2.04 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.93%. CocaCola's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 81.60%.

Insider Activity

In related news, CFO John Murphy sold 88,658 shares of the firm's stock in a transaction that occurred on Wednesday, May 7th. The shares were sold at an average price of $72.09, for a total value of $6,391,355.22.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ief financial officer now owns 205,511 shares in the company, valued at $14,815,287.99. This trade represents a 30.14% decrease in their position. CocaCola Company Profile

(Free Report)

The Coca-Cola Company, a beverage company, manufactures, markets, and sells various nonalcoholic beverages worldwide. The company provides sparkling soft drinks, sparkling flavors; water, sports, coffee, and tea; juice, value-added dairy, and plant-based beverages; and other beverages. It also offers beverage concentrates and syrups, as well as fountain syrups to fountain retailers, such as restaurants and convenience stores.
